  8. I was referring to what happens after a month. If you close an account with company X they will give you a PAC. It stands for Porting Authorisation Code. If you move to company Y within a month and give them your PAC then your number will be retained on (ported to) the new account with company Y. If you leave it more than a month then the PAC expires and your number is lost to you.

  19. Note that a 5-battery bank becomes a 10-battery bank if you go for Trojan T105s as they’re 6V batteries. It’s easy to overlook that when you’re budgeting for space and cost.
